Automation is an important issue when integrating heterogeneous collections into archaeological digital libraries. We propose an incremental approach through intermediary- and mapping-based techniques. A visual schema mapping tool within the 5S [1] framework allows semi-automatic mapping and incremental global schema enrichment. 5S also helped speed up development of a new multi-dimension browsing service. Our approach helps integrate the Megiddo [2] excavation data into a growing union archaeological DL, ETANA-DL [3].
